-- Hoogle documentation, generated by Haddock -- See Hoogle, http://www.haskell.org/hoogle/ -- | JavaScriptCore bindings -- -- Bindings for JavaScriptCore, autogenerated by haskell-gi. @package gi-javascriptcore @version 0.2.10.13 module GI.JavaScriptCore.Types module GI.JavaScriptCore.Callbacks module GI.JavaScriptCore.Structs.GlobalContext newtype GlobalContext GlobalContext :: (ForeignPtr GlobalContext) -> GlobalContext noGlobalContext :: Maybe GlobalContext instance (info Data.Type.Equality.~ GI.JavaScriptCore.Structs.GlobalContext.ResolveGlobalContextMethod t GI.JavaScriptCore.Structs.GlobalContext.GlobalContext, Data.GI.Base.Overloading.MethodInfo info GI.JavaScriptCore.Structs.GlobalContext.GlobalContext p) => Data.GI.Base.Overloading.IsLabelProxy t (GI.JavaScriptCore.Structs.GlobalContext.GlobalContext -> p) instance (info Data.Type.Equality.~ GI.JavaScriptCore.Structs.GlobalContext.ResolveGlobalContextMethod t GI.JavaScriptCore.Structs.GlobalContext.GlobalContext, Data.GI.Base.Overloading.MethodInfo info GI.JavaScriptCore.Structs.GlobalContext.GlobalContext p) => GHC.OverloadedLabels.IsLabel t (GI.JavaScriptCore.Structs.GlobalContext.GlobalContext -> p) module GI.JavaScriptCore.Structs.Value newtype Value Value :: (ForeignPtr Value) -> Value noValue :: Maybe Value instance (info Data.Type.Equality.~ GI.JavaScriptCore.Structs.Value.ResolveValueMethod t GI.JavaScriptCore.Structs.Value.Value, Data.GI.Base.Overloading.MethodInfo info GI.JavaScriptCore.Structs.Value.Value p) => Data.GI.Base.Overloading.IsLabelProxy t (GI.JavaScriptCore.Structs.Value.Value -> p) instance (info Data.Type.Equality.~ GI.JavaScriptCore.Structs.Value.ResolveValueMethod t GI.JavaScriptCore.Structs.Value.Value, Data.GI.Base.Overloading.MethodInfo info GI.JavaScriptCore.Structs.Value.Value p) => GHC.OverloadedLabels.IsLabel t (GI.JavaScriptCore.Structs.Value.Value -> p) module GI.JavaScriptCore.Structs module GI.JavaScriptCore